U+0AAE "" Gujarati Letter Ma is the representation of the consonant "ma" in the Gujarati script, which is used to write the Gujarati language primarily in the Indian state of Gujarat. This character corresponds to the bilabial nasal sound /m/ and is derived from the ancient Brahmi script, appearing as a distinct glyph with a rounded top and a horizontal bar in its standard form. As part of the Gujarati Unicode block, it serves as a fundamental building block for spelling and writing words in Gujarati, and when combined with vowel signs or other diacritics, it modifies its inherent vowel sound. The letter "મ" is common in everyday Gujarati text, appearing in words like "માતા" meaning mother and "મન" meaning mind, making it an essential character for accurate written communication in the language.
